HOUSE BILL 1319

AN ACT relative to the percentage of ownership in physician hospital organizations.

ANALYSIS

This bill limits the percentage of ownership certain persons may have in physician hospital organizations.

STATE OF NEW HAMPSHIRE

In the Year of Our Lord Two Thousand Three

AN ACT relative to the percentage of ownership in physician hospital organizations.

Be it Enacted by the Senate and House of Representatives in General Court convened:

1 New Section; Limiting Percentage of Ownership in Physician Hospital Organizations. Amend RSA 151 by inserting after section 31 the following new section:

151:32 Percentage of Ownership Limited in Physician Hospital Organizations. Notwithstanding any provision of law to the contrary, the percentage of ownership in a physician hospital organization by a physician, nurse, or any other person having the ability to refer patients shall not exceed 15 percent.

2 Effective Date. This act shall take effect 60 days after its passage.
